Shifa name meaning:

The name Shifa is of Arabic origin and has a beautiful meaning. It is primarily used as a girl's name and carries various interpretations, all associated with healing and curing. In Arabic, the word "Shifa" itself means "to heal," "to cure," or "to make better." As a name, Shifa symbolizes the qualities of compassion, nurturing, and the ability to bring physical, emotional, or spiritual healing to others.

The name Shifa also holds significance in Islamic culture, where it is associated with the healing powers of Allah. It represents the belief in divine intervention and the power of prayer to bring comfort and solace during times of illness or distress.
